What is a Dried Flower?
Dried flower refers to the cured and dried cannabis buds that have been trimmed from the cannabis plant. These buds are the most potent part of the plant, containing the highest concentration of cannabinoids like THC, CBD, and terpenes, which influence both the effects and the aroma of the flower.
The journey of cannabis begins with a healthy, vibrant cannabis plant. Once it is harvested, the plant is carefully cured and dried to preserve its potency. This process involves removing the moisture from the buds while maintaining the essential oils and compounds that give cannabis its distinctive properties. Once properly dried, the flower is ready for consumption.
For centuries, dried flower has been a traditional way to consume cannabis, requiring no specialized equipment.
How to Prepare Dried Flower for Use ?
One of the best things about dried flowers is their versatility. There are countless ways to enjoy it, whether you prefer to roll a joint, pack a pipe or bong, or even prepare it for cooking. Here are some common methods of preparation:
Grinding the Flower
While you can technically break apart the buds by hand, using a weed grinder is the most efficient way to prepare dried flowers. A grinder helps prepare the flower for consistent burning. It also helps release valuable trichomes, the tiny resin glands that contain cannabinoids and terpenes, which improve the overall effects.
There are several types of grinders, ranging from two-piece to four-piece designs. A four-piece grinder includes a screen to catch the kief (the trichomes), which can be collected and used later for an extra potent experience.

Vaping Dried Flower
Vaporizers offer an excellent alternative to traditional smoking. Vaping heats the cannabis flower to the point where the cannabinoids are released in vapor form, without combustion. This method is smoother on the lungs and throat compared to smoking, and it preserves the delicate terpenes that contribute to cannabis’ distinctive aroma and flavor.
Not all vaporizers are compatible with dried flowers, so it is important to check if your device supports flower use. For vaporizers that do, simply grind the flower to a medium consistency, pack it into the heating chamber, and you are good to go. Vaporizers offer an alternative method of consuming cannabis.
Cooking with Dried Flower
Cannabis-infused edibles are another wonderful way to consume dried flower, though this requires some preparation. First, the flower needs to be decarboxylated, a process that involves gently heating the flower to activate its cannabinoids. Once decarboxylated, the flower can be infused into oils, butter, or other cooking ingredients to make your favorite edibles.

Sizes of Dried Flower Available
Dried flowers are available in many sizes to suit different consumers’ needs. Whether you need a small amount for a quick sesh or prefer to stock up for a longer period, there is a perfect size for everyone.
3.5g (Eighth): This is the most common size and is perfect for casual users or those trying out a new strain. An eighth provides enough flowers for several sessions and is ideal for those who do not smoke every day.
14g (Quarter): If you are a regular consumer or enjoy a variety of strains, a quarter is a great option. It offers a respectable number of flowers for a longer-lasting supply.
28g (Ounce): For those who consume frequently or are looking to save money by purchasing in bulk, a full ounce of dried flower is an excellent choice. It is economical, and buying in larger quantities often offers better value.
